My Question or Issue

When I click play on any playlist, the songs just load the title and then skip to the next one over and over again.

When I click on an individual song, the error "Spotify can't play this right now".

 

It was working two days ago when I first downloaded it and hasn't worked since. It's a brand new PC.

The Spotify program does this on Windows when it detects an error with the currect audio device. You have to either switch audio devices, restart the current audio device, or reboot Windows.

 

Spotify devs are terrible at conveying these sorts of issues with the end user.

 

It may even do this if there is no audio device to grab. There's no expection handling with bad audio devices. It expects to always get a working audio device from Windows, then shits the bed if it doesn't.
